WebThe use of the phrase became widespread during the United States presidential election of 1828, in which the enthusiastic supporters of Andrew Jackson were called 'whole hog' Jacksonites. An early example of that usage is found in The Middlesex Gazette, January 1828: Mr. Barbour, you know, was formerly the Speaker, but not being willing "to go ...
WebMar 15, 2024 · Step 2: Field-dress it. Once you have your hog cleaned, you need to field-dress it. Some prefer to scald the hog first to remove the hair, but I like to go ahead and get the pig opened up and cooling, especially in warm-weather hunting conditions. Start the process just like you would on a deer or other game animal.
